ABOUT THE ROLE
The Product Data Science team is G2's centralized analytics and data science function, embedded within the Product org to support Product Leadership and the teams building our buyer experience and reviews platform. In this role, you'll partner closely with product stakeholders to develop data-driven strategies that improve the product and deliver measurable outcomes. You'll also drive self-service initiatives, giving end users direct access to insights through dashboards and MCP-powered tooling. Day-to-day, you'll work across a modern data stack including Looker, Snowflake, Amplitude, Python, and R, applying experimentation frameworks and data storytelling techniques to turn complex analysis into clear, actionable recommendations.
IN THIS ROLE, YOU WILL:
- Design and build data products that generate actionable insights for both internal stakeholders and external customers
- Develop and deploy AI agents and MCP-powered tooling to enable self-service access to data across the organization
- Own and contribute to key OKRs through data-led initiatives, partnering closely with Product Leadership and cross-functional teams
- Improve data quality, documentation, and governance practices to ensure the data layer is accurate, trusted, and AI-ready
- Lead exploratory and ad-hoc analyses for product and leadership partners, synthesizing complex data into clear, decision-ready recommendations
- Build and maintain BI infrastructure in Looker and Amplitude, including dashboards, explores, and self-service reporting layers
- Act as a data thought partner to product teams, proactively surfacing insights, flagging risks, and shaping strategy through a data lens
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
We realize applying for jobs can feel daunting at times. Even if you don’t check all the boxes in the job description, we encourage you to apply anyway.
- 3–5 years in product analytics, including direct experience defining and owning core product metrics end to end
- Strong proficiency in SQL
- Experience with at least one BI tool (Looker, Tableau, Power BI, Sigma, etc.)
- Experiences working with Python and/or R for analysis and automation in a production environment
- Familiarity with AI workflows, LLM tooling, or agentic data products
-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to translate complex analysis into clear recommendations for non-technical stakeholders
- Self-motivated and collaborative, with a track record of owning projects end-to-end
WHAT CAN HELP YOUR APPLICATION STAND OUT:
- Experience with A/B testing or experimentation frameworks preferred
- Experience contributing to data governance initiatives a plus

How We Use AI Technology in Our Hiring Process G2 incorporates AI-powered technology to enhance our candidate evaluation process. These tools may assist with initial application screening, skills assessment analysis, and identifying candidates whose qualifications align with specific role requirements. While AI technology supports our recruitment workflow, all final hiring decisions remain under human oversight and judgment.
Your Choice Matters: If you would prefer that your application be reviewed without AI assistance, you can opt out by entering your email address in the email entry field at the bottom of the Automated Processing Legal Notice. Choosing to opt out will not disadvantage your application in any way—we will ensure your materials receive a thorough manual review by our hiring team.
